A supernatural-fiction book set in Rome during the 19th century.
"Resting Place of Many Souls" unfurls a riveting narrative mingling historical romance and gothic elements. Engage as the complexities of the magical and ancient city, resonating with the remnants of pagan and Christian epochs, shape the fates of our protagonists.The Mystery Begins
Within the echoing halls of a Roman sculpture gallery, our characters find their fates entwined. Here exists a gifted painter named Miriam, the serene Hilda from New England, a dedicated sculptor called Kenyon, and the dreamingly cheerful Italian, Donatello. Etched in stone, an uncanny resemblance between Donatello and a statue of Praxiteles' Faun brings forth the first spark of intrigue.Grim Encounters
The novel plunges into darker depths when the group ventures to the gloomy catacombs of St. Calixtus. On losing her way, Miriam stumbles upon a spectral figure from bygone days, and this fleeting encounter tragically haunts her life, seeping into her artwork and dreams as the Specter of the Catacombs.Mysterious Past & Haunting Present
We then delve into Miriam's enigmatic past, revealing ominous conjectures about her origin and previous deeds. Her life further complicates with the appearance of a nefarious monk, a timeless entity who disrupts her presently haunted life. A terrifying encounter and the monk's untimely demise at a Capuchin monastery leave scars that may never heal.The Truth Strikes
In the awakening of Chapter Twenty-Two, the intensity escalates when Hilda, bearing witness to a horrifying event involving Miriam and Donatello, confronts Miriam, unearthing lingering doubts about her friend's morality and guilt.End of a Saga
As our story draws to a close, haunted by the ghosts of their past, Donatello and Miriam are forced to endure the pain of separation.
